Was still discussing with mum yesterday about Ojude Oba, how this no money we are shouting up and down will not stop anything, it will go down as usual. It's always the aso-okes combinations that get me excited, see colors naaw, then the horses and all. See women properly dressed in native attires and looking so peng, you can't even try to wear 'omo wobe' cloth around them the kind bombastic side eyes those aunties will give you ehn. And we always get to see 'properly sewn' Agbadas on the men. Kekere Ijebu owoni Agba Ijebu Owo ni And then you see the display of wealth. |
